On October 1st, Catalonia took the world by surprise by conducting an illegal vote on the question of independence from Spain. In response, Spanish police raided polling stations, fired rubber bullets, and injured more than 800 people.
To understand this surprising new chapter in a long and historic conflict between Catalonia and Spain, we invited Dr. Sandie Holguin, a modern Spanish historian, to explain the chaotic circumstances surrounding this secret vote and the political uncertainty ahead. Special Guest: Dr. Sandie Holguin.
